The Rise of Live CSV Feeds: Real-Time Data in a Simple Format

CSV files were once static snapshots — exported once, analyzed once, and quickly forgotten. But in recent years, the concept of live CSV feeds has changed that. Developers now use streaming CSV endpoints to push real-time data updates to dashboards and analytics tools.

It’s an interesting mix of old and new. The humble CSV format, combined with automation and cloud infrastructure, can now support near real-time reporting. Think of IoT sensors sending status updates, stock exchanges updating live prices, or logistics platforms feeding delivery status changes — all formatted in CSV.

Tools like Google Sheets and Airtable even let users publish “live CSV links” that update automatically. It’s a simple, human-readable way to stream structured data without complex APIs or heavy file formats.

Of course, live CSV feeds have limits — they’re not ideal for massive datasets or secure environments. But their ease of use makes them perfect for quick integrations, internal dashboards, or public data updates.
